The Rocky Hill School
Independent
Rocky Hill School is a prestigious independent day school serving students from preschool through grade 12. Located just 15 minutes from North Kingstown, the school offers a rigorous college preparatory curriculum with exceptional STEM programs and unique marine science opportunities leveraging its coastal location. The 84-acre campus features state-of-the-art facilities including science labs, innovation spaces, and athletic facilities. The school emphasizes personalized learning with small class sizes and has a strong track record of college placements to top universities.

Moses Brown School
Independent Quaker School
Moses Brown School is one of New England's most respected independent schools with a rich Quaker heritage. Serving students from nursery through grade 12, the school offers a challenging academic program with extensive Advanced Placement options and innovative STEM facilities. The 33-acre campus includes modern science centers, arts facilities, and athletic complexes. The school's Quaker values inform its educational approach, emphasizing community, social responsibility, and intellectual curiosity. Many families from North Kingstown commute to this Providence-based institution for its exceptional college preparation and comprehensive programs.

Lincoln School
Independent Girls' School
Lincoln School is Rhode Island's only independent school for girls, offering education from preschool through grade 12. The school provides a comprehensive International Baccalaureate program alongside traditional college preparatory courses. Known for its strong emphasis on developing female leaders in STEM fields, the school features specialized science and technology facilities. The urban campus in Providence serves students from throughout the region, including North Kingstown families seeking single-gender education with proven academic outcomes and extensive extracurricular opportunities in arts, athletics, and community service.
